    I made a reservation a couple weeks to a month prior before coming to bestia. We had a reservation at 5:15 PM, and were seated right when the doors opened at 5 PM. We got to sit outside on the side patio which was a very nice experience. We started off with the Housemade buttermilk ricotta which was $16 and absolutely delicious. The ricotta literally melts in your mouth!! I also got the roasted Marrowbone for $22. The spinach gnocchetti was delightful and the crispy breadcrumbs added a great texture to the dish. The Spicy lamb sausage pizza ($21) was probably the highlight of my night. I have literally been dreaming about the next time I’ll be eating this pizza again.. We ended with the Cavatelli alla Norcina pasta ($35) which was pretty good! The pictures of this pasta definitely looks much better than the actual dish. It was pretty underwhelming for the price point, but it was well seasoned and the black truffle was a nice touch. Overall, I’m definitely planning to come back and try some more pizzas and other dishes. However, because it was so busy, our server kept changing and we were never sure who we would be speaking.

    I came here for my birthday dinner with my boyfriend, and everything I ate here blew me away from beginning to the end. First off, the Herb Caesar Salad is NOTHING like your typical caesar salad. This one was from heaven or something. The blend of herbs and spices on it tasted so unique but pleasantly complementary. They also top it off with squid ink breadcrumbs and lemon zest. I’d say that was my favorite dish because it just blew me away. The next thing we had was the Squid Ink Chitarra. Most italian restaurants overyhype their squid ink dishes so I thought this would just taste average, but Bestia exceeded my expectations. Next, we had was the Roasted Marrow Bone. Holy smokes. The umami flavor was very powerful and so good. The gnocchi is made from spinach but it tastes very good and doesn’t taste like grass. Last pasta dish we had was the Cavatelli alla Norcina. This truffle pasta was so delicious. The flavor was light and savory at the same time. Lastly, the dessert was AWESOME. Most expensive restaurants disappoint me at times because their dessert is so average but Bestia has THE BEST desserts. We got the (1) Strawberry Buttermilk Ice Cream and Coconut Gelato Frozen Tarte and (2) Coconut Macadamia Caramel Tart. THIS WAS HEAVEN. THE BEST. So light and sweet and refreshing at the same time. All the food here tastes light yet savory. Portion size runs small but I prefer that because I don’t like eating huge portions in general. The restaurant itself is a little too loud for my liking. The food also does come out slowly and it can be hard to get the waiter’s attention. You also have to pay for parking, but where do you not in downtown LA?
